Employer Information

USD 420 Osage City is a Class 3A school district with a student enrollment of 700 students.  Osage City Elementary has grades PK-5 with approximately 350 students.  Osage City Middle School has approximately 150 students in grades 6-8 and the high school has approximately 220 students.  A successful $6.5 million dollar bond election was held in January of 1999.  Construction of a new high school, auditorium and multi-purpose room were completed during the spring of 2002.   In 2012, another bond of $6.7 million dollars was passed by a 2:1 ratio to renovate the elementary school, build a track/football complex, and a new storm shelter/gymnasium.   Osage City is a member of the Flint Hills Activities League and offers a variety of extra-curricular activities.

Osage City is a community of over 3,000 people and is located 35 minutes southwest of Topeka, Kansas and also has convenient access to Emporia, Ottawa and Kansas City.  Osage City lies between Lake Pomona and Melvern Lake and has many recreational opportunities including a city golf course, parks, and  an aquatic center.
